仙灵骨葆对去势大鼠骨量和生物力学性能的影响邢磊焦颖华1耿丽华孙尧(河北联合大学附属医院老年病科,河北唐山063000)〔摘要〕目的探讨仙灵骨葆对骨质疏松(OP )大鼠骨量、骨代谢和生物力学性能的影响。

方法3月龄雌性SD 大鼠24只分为3组,每组8只:正常对照组(N )、卵巢切除组(OVX )、卵巢切除+仙灵骨葆治疗组(XLGB )。

除N 组外,其余两组行卵巢切除术,6w 后XLGB 组给予药物干预:250mg ·kg -1·d -1,OVX 组给予等量生理盐水,8w 后处死所有大鼠。

留取尿液、血清检测血PINP 值、尿DPYD /Cr 、NTX /Cr 值。

取左侧股骨行骨密度测定,取左侧胫骨制备硬组织不脱钙切片,备行骨组织形态计量学检测,取右侧股骨行三点弯曲试验,检测其最大载荷。

结果OVX 组血PINP 、尿DPYD /Cr 、尿NTX /Cr 值显著高于N 组,XLGB 能显著降低血PINP 、尿DPYD /Cr 、尿NTX /Cr 值,但仍显著高于N 组。

OVX 组股骨全长及近、中、远三段骨密度均显著低于N 组,XLGB 组近、远端骨密度显著高于OVX 组。

BV /TV 在OVX 组显著低于N 组,XLGB 组显著高于OVX 组;OVX 、XLGB 组骨吸收指标Oc.N 、Er.Pm 均显著高于N 组,XLGB 组Oc.N 、Er.Pm 显著低于OVX 组,BFR /BV 显著高于OVX 组。

最大载荷三组之间无显著差别。

结论仙灵骨葆灌胃可抑制卵巢切除大鼠骨量丢失,其机制与促进骨形成、抑制骨吸收,降低骨转换水平,进而维持骨量及微观结构有关。

仙珍骨宝干预泼尼松诱发大鼠的骨丢失许碧莲;陈广斌;陈文双;张新乐;吴铁;崔燎【摘要】BACKGROUND: Xianzhengubao capsule made from Cnidium, Epimedium and others has a certain protective role in glucocorticoid and retinoic acid-induced osteoporosis.rnOBJECTIVE: To study the effect of Xianzhengubao on different bones in prednisone-treated rats by bone histomorphometry and bone biomechanics methods.rnMETHODS: Thirty-two Sprague-Dawley rats were randomly divided into control, prednisone, high- and low-dose Xianzhengubao groups. Rats in the latter groups were given prednisone at 3.5 mg/kg-d first to establish osteoporosis models. High- and low-dose Xianzhengubao groups were administrated with Xianzhengubao capsule at 0.95 g/kg-d and 0.475 g/kg-d, respectively, after prednisone treatment.rnRESULTS AND CONCLUSION: Compared with the control group, bone mineral density and biomechanical properties (elastic load, maximum load, break load) of the femur were significantly decreased in the prednisone group. Percent labeled perimeter, bone formation rate per bone surface and per unit of bone volume of the proximal tibial metaphysis were decreased in the prednisone group, but there was no significant difference both in static parameters of proximal tibial metaphysis and in tibial shaft. Compared with the prednisone group, bone mineral density and biomechanical properties of the femur, percent labeled perimeter and bone formation rate per bone surfaceof the proximal tibial metaphysis were increased, but there was no significantchange in tibial shaft in the high-dose Xianzhengubao group. Compared with the prednisone group, there was no significant change in the low-dose Xianzhengubao group. 仙灵骨葆治疗骨质疏松的临床疗效目的评价仙灵骨葆治疗骨质疏松症的临床疗效和安全性,为骨质疏松症的治疗找到一种安全、方便、有效的途径。

方法选择84例骨质疏松患者,随就诊先后时间将84例患者平均分为治疗组与对照组,治疗组选择仙灵骨葆胶囊治疗,对照组选择乐力胶囊治疗,比较两组疗效。

结果两组药物均对骨质疏松症有明显的疗效,服用仙灵骨葆的治疗组在治疗原发性骨质疏松的各方面数据均优于服用乐力胶囊的对照组。

两组不良反应发生率时比差异有显著性(P<0.05)。

结论运用纯中药仙灵劳葆治疗骨质硫松,能有效缓解甘质疏松临床症状、增加骨密度,乐力胶囊疗效对某些人而言有不良反应。

标签:仙灵骨堡;骨质疏松;临床试验骨质疏松是由于种原因引发的钙盐流失而导致全身骨病,其中原因以年龄和女性内分泌水平低下最为多见。

临床症状多为易骨折、产生疼痛、乏力及下肢麻木等。

临床治疗主要以补钙或加用少量激素治疗,但疗效低下,虽能缓解症状,但停药后症状很快复发,且副作用较大。

我院选择中药制剂仙灵骨葆治疗骨质疏松,疗效显著,现报道如下。

仙灵骨葆胶囊治疗骨质疏松症的疗效及其对骨代谢及骨转换指标的影响分析摘要:目的探析研究仙灵骨葆胶囊治疗骨质疏松症的疗效及其对骨代谢及骨转换指标的影响。

方法在本院2015年5月-2017年6月间收治的骨质疏松症患者中选择70例进行分组治疗,对照组采取常规治疗,观察组则加以使用仙灵骨葆胶囊进行治疗,各35例。

结果2组对比治疗效果,显示观察组总有效率为94.3%,对照组为77.1%,对比差异明显(P<0.05)。

对比两组骨密度(BMD)、骨钙素(OC)、I型胶原交联C-末端肽(CTX-1),提示观察组更佳(P<0.05);对比血清钙(Ca)、磷(P)以及碱性磷酸酶(ALP)等指标则提示差异不明显(P>0.05)。

治疗期间2组均未见明显不良反应。

结论仙灵骨葆胶囊治疗骨质疏松症的效果显著,可有效改善骨转换状态及骨密度,值得推广。

新仙灵骨葆胶囊对大鼠骨折愈合的影响研究目的:研究新仙灵骨葆胶囊对大鼠骨折愈合的影响,为寻求“减量增效(减量等效)”新组方提供参考。

方法:将大鼠随机分为假手术组(蒸馏水)、模型组(蒸馏水)、仙灵骨葆胶囊组(350 mg/kg)和新仙灵骨葆胶囊低、中、高剂量组(53、105、210 mg/kg),每组14只。

除假手术组外,其余各组大鼠均在麻醉状态下制作右侧股骨中段骨折模型。

待大鼠术后清醒,各组大鼠灌胃相应药物10 mL/kg,每天给药1次,连续4周。

末次给药后,测定大鼠体质量,观察骨折处骨痂形成及组织病理学变化,进行骨折侧生物力学(骨折应力、骨压碎力)测量,并采用酶联免疫吸附法检测血清中炎症因子[肿瘤坏死因子α(TNF-α)、白细胞介素1β(IL-1β)] 水平。

结果:与假手术组比较,模型组大鼠体质量和骨折侧骨折应力、骨压碎力明显降低(P<0.05或P<0.01),血清中TNF-α、IL-1β水平明显升高(P<0.01);模型组大鼠骨折周围可见明显骨痂形成,骨小梁不成熟、排列混乱。

与模型组比较,新仙灵骨葆胶囊高剂量组和仙灵骨葆胶囊组大鼠体质量明显增加(P<0.05),新仙灵骨葆胶囊中、高剂量组和仙灵骨葆胶囊组大鼠骨折侧骨折应力明显升高(P<0.05或P<0.01),各给药组大鼠血清中TNF-α、IL-1β水平均明显降低(P<0.01);且新仙灵骨葆胶囊各剂量组与仙灵骨葆胶囊组比较上述指标差异均无统计学意义(P>0.05)。

各给药组大鼠骨痂面积均变小,骨折线变模糊,骨折痕迹基本消失,骨小梁数量增多;骨折处皮质层增厚,骨髓腔见大量毛细血管植入。

结论:新仙灵骨葆胶囊具有明显的促进骨折愈合作用,可有效提高骨生物力学强度,抑制炎症反应。
